New menu on this spookiest of days! We rolled out a lot of new goodies yesterday, some of which are pictured here. I am partial to the bomboloni and the “Love From Hanover”, the roast pork sandwich with pretzels and blueberry mustard.
This menu is a window into the passions that started Epilogue. Each page has a theme, each item a conceptual storyline as well as a utilitarian purpose. This menu is for me, to talk to you.
For the moment, longtime standards are gone. No pierogi, no pork chop, no chicken at all. But we have 7 animal proteins represented on the menu. An equal number of vegetarian presentations. It is still an egalitarian selection of dishes designed to welcome all walks, but I am leaning heavier into the food designs that make me happy. Like a fish egg donut. Flavors that clash without a bridge, but work wonderfully with one, like the apple and cocoa in the duck leg. There is more opportunity with this menu to understand how i view food, the construction of a plate, and my personal philosophy on why we turn sustenance into art (not Art).
